Transaction 62d9eab3f02cd8d9100d879315572be0eb44c549a73a4e0c3df361cdd88c6e6c
1 Input
1 Output
-
62d9eab3f02cd8d9100d879315572be0eb44c549a73a4e0c3df361cdd88c6e6c:0
- value
- 1580813
- script pubkey
- OP_0 OP_PUSHBYTES_20 1df21fcde491be203ed32a30c37bea011c756d1a
- address
- bc1qrhepln0yjxlzq0kn9gcvx7l2qyw82mg6sasq43